🌿 What is Gum Disease?

Gum disease, also known as periodontal disease, is a bacterial infection of the tissues that support your teeth. It begins as gingivitis (inflammation of the gums) and can progress to periodontitis, which affects the bone and can eventually lead to tooth loss if untreated.

🚩 Common Signs of Gum Disease

Early symptoms can be subtle — but catching it early makes all the difference.

Watch for:

  • Bleeding when brushing or flossing

  • Red, swollen, or tender gums

  • Persistent bad breath or bad taste

  • Gum recession (gums pulling away from teeth)

  • Loose teeth or changes in bite

Pain-Free Tip: If your gums bleed regularly — don’t ignore it. Healthy gums should not bleed.

🦠 What Causes Gum Disease?

The main cause is plaque — a sticky film of bacteria that builds up around your teeth and gums.

Other contributing factors include:

  • Poor oral hygiene

  • Smoking

  • Diabetes

  • Hormonal changes (pregnancy, menopause)

  • Genetics

  • Stress and poor diet

Without proper cleaning, plaque hardens into tartar, which traps more bacteria and worsens inflammation.

🧠 Gum Disease Affects More Than Just Your Mouth

Studies have linked gum disease to serious health conditions such as:

  • Heart disease

  • Stroke

  • Diabetes complications

  • Pregnancy issues (preterm birth, low birth weight)

  • Respiratory infections
